Pathways to Promised Lands is the first installment in an enlightening three-book series exploring the profound spiritual journeys that shape our understanding of divine promises and sacred destinations. This comprehensive volume delves into the concept of promised lands across major world religions, drawing on the rich tapestry of historical narratives, scriptural insights, and personal reflections.

In Pathways to Promised Lands, readers are guided through the diverse landscapes of religious traditions, including Christianity, Islam, Judaism, Buddhism, Hinduism, and the LDS faith. The book examines the sacred pilgrimages and ultimate spiritual aspirations that define the journey toward promised lands, highlighting the interplay of personal transformation and communal effort.

Pathways to Promised Lands sets the stage for a deeper exploration of sacred history and spiritual fulfillment. The second book in the series, From Jerusalem to Zarahemla, will trace the remarkable journey of Lehi's family and their descendants, focusing on their trials, triumphs, and spiritual legacy. The final book, From Zarahemla to Cumorah, will continue the narrative, examining the Nephite civilization's rise and fall and the profound lessons their story offers.
